新疆两色金鸡菊中原花青素含量测定体系考察

         

摘要

To select the appropriate standards and chromogenic reaction system for determination the content of proanthocyanidins in Coreopsis tinctoria flowering tops (CTFT) from Xinjiang, the spectrum of CTFT extract, catechin and proanthocyanidins standards were compared in vanillin-hydrochloric acid, n-butanol-hydrochlo-ric acid, Fe3+catalytic chromogenic method and pH differential spectrophotometry reaction system. The spectral absorption curve and the wavelengthλmax peak values were investigated for selecting a suitable reaction system to determine the content of proanthocyanidins of CTFT. The spectrum of CTFT extract and proanthocyanidins stan-dard were similar in n-butanol-hydrochloric acid, Fe3+chromogenic method and pH differential spectrophotom-etry reaction system, and theλmax values were also closer to standard. Therefore, the content of proanthocyani-dins in CTFT could be assayed by these three chromogenic reaction system. The content of proanthocyanidins in CTFT could be accurately determined in a particular reaction system and using an appropriate standard.%为准确测定新疆两色金鸡中原花青素含量,选择合适的对照品和测定体系.通过比较香草醛-盐酸、正丁醇-盐酸、铁盐(Fe3+)催化法、pH示差法等多种测定体系下,两色金鸡菊提取物和对照品儿茶素或原花青素的连续波长扫描图谱,考察光谱吸收曲线的一致性和λmax峰位值,进而选择适合测定两色金鸡菊中原花青素含量的显色反应体系.结果表明,两色金鸡菊提取物与原花青素对照品在正丁醇-盐酸、Fe3+催化法和pH示差法产生的光谱吸收曲线相似,λmax峰位值更接近.因此,可以用这3种体系快速测定两色金鸡菊中原花青素的含量.结果显示,在特定的测定体系中,选择合适的对照品能准确测定新疆两色金鸡菊中原花青素的含量.
